Is Gilead a Good Place to Live?
Economy & Jobs
Gilead residents earn a median household income of $65,313 , which is 13%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$34,464. The unemployment rate stands at 0.0% (100%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 0.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 262 business establishments, including 14 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in Gilead is $55,000 , 80%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$82,857. The cost of living index is 90.1 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1974.
Safety & Crime
Gilead reports 53 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 86%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 693/100K.
Education
29.2% of adults in Gilead hold a bachelor's degree or higher (13% below the national average). 83.3%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.3/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
Gilead has an average annual temperature of 52°F (11°C). Winters average 25°F in January while summers reach 77°F in July. The area gets 275 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 32.4 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 32.
